Randy Shaver Cancer Research And Community Fund

Organization Overview

Randy Shaver Cancer Research And Community Fund is located in Minnetonka, MN. The organization was established in 2009. According to its NTEE Classification (H12) the organization is classified as: Fund Raising & Fund Distribution, under the broad grouping of Medical Research and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Randy Shaver Cancer Research And Community Fund is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 01/2024, Randy Shaver Cancer Research And Community Fund generated $1.3m in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 8 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 7.9%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$1.3m during the year ending 01/2024. While expenses have increased by 2.7% per year over the past 8 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Since 2015, Randy Shaver Cancer Research And Community Fund has awarded 143 individual grants totaling $7,413,537. If you would like to learn more about the grant giving history of this organization, scroll down to the grant profile section of this page.

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

THE MISSION OF THE RANDY SHAVER CANCER RESEARCH AND COMMUNITY FUND IS TO ASSIST AND SUPPORT THE CANCER COMMUNITY IN MINNESOTA BY FUNDING RESEARCH, PREVENTION, TREATMENT AND OTHER PROGRAMS RELATING TO THE CANCER COMMUNITY'S PRINCIPAL NEEDS.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

THE RANDY SHAVER CANCER RESEARCH AND COMMUNITY FUND SUPPORTS THE CANCER COMMUNITY IN MINNESOTA BY FUNDING RESEARCH, PREVENTION, TREATMENT AND COMMUNITY OUTREACH PROGRAMS RELATING TO CANCER. WHAT MAKES THIS FUND SO UNIQUE IS THAT A NOMINAL AMOUNT OF THE MONIES RAISED ARE SPENT ON ADMINISTRATIVE COSTS, MAKING IT ONE OF THE MOST EFFICIENT USES OF CHARITABLE DONATIONS. GRANTS GIVEN ARE SPENT ON TECHNOLOGY AND TOOLS THAT ENHANCE EARLY DETECTION OF CANCER, NEW PROGRAMS PROMOTING RESEARCH TO HELP PREVENT CANCER RELAPSES, PROJECTS THAT DEMONSTRATE RESEARCH IN THE AREA OF CANCER, AND PROGRAMS THAT ENHANCE THE LIVES OF MINNESOTA'S CANCER COMMUNITY BY PROVIDING AID AND ASSISTANCE. SEE THE 990, SCHEDULE I FOR THE FULL LIST OF AMOUNTS GIVEN. FUNDRAISING EVENTS FOR THE YEAR INCLUDED: TACKLE CANCER, SHAVER SPECIALS AT ROCK ELM TAVERN AND BIG BORE BARBECUE, CARPS CANCER CRUSHERS-CRIBBAGE TOURNAMENT AND GOLF TOURNAMENT, TAKE DOWN CANCER EVENTS, SWIM AND DIVE EVENTS, SHOOT OUT CANCER HOCKEY EVENTS, STRIKE OUT CANCER EVENTS, GIVE MN, CAR DEALERSHIP FUNDRAISING IN OCTOBER, AND DROPSHOT CANCER PICKLEBALL TOURNAMENT.
